Man due in court over death in West Lothian

- By JAMIE MCKENZIE

A man is due to appear in court today over the death of a 35-year-old man in West Lothian at the weekend.

Dean Ritchie, from Blackburn, died at an address in the town’s Mosside Drive in the early hours of Saturday. Police and paramedics were called at around 12.50am and the 35-yearold was pronounced dead at the scene.police said a 25-year-old man has been arrested and charged in connection with the death. He is due to appear at Livingston Sheriff Court today.

Detective Chief Inspector Cameron Miller from Police Scotland said: “Dean’s family has been left devastated and it is vital we find answers for them. We are continuing inquiries in order to piece together Dean’s movements prior to his death and to establish the full circumstan­ces of what happened.”anyone with informatio­n should contact Police Scotland’s Major Investigat­ion Team via 101, quoting incident number 0208 of Saturday, 12 June, 2021.
